Twitter是否对其OAuth API使用任何类型的权限?

时间:2012-01-02 22:55:00

标签: api rest twitter

在Facebook API中:

“当用户允许您在auth对话框中访问其基本信息时,您可以访问其用户ID,名称,... 要访问有关用户或其朋友的任何其他信息,您需要向用户请求特定权限。“

因此,Facebook默认情况下允许使用具有受限权限的API,然后它会专门请求您可能使用的各种权限。

在Twitter中,当用户被重定向到“account / verify_credentials”上的twitter弹出窗口时,弹出窗口显示: “这个应用程序将能够:

Read Tweets from your timeline.
See who you follow, and follow new people.
Update your profile.
Post Tweets for you."

它基本上给了我权限,我不需要立即开始,它可能会驱使用户远离给我这样的权限(我不会责怪他们)

有没有办法获得受限制的权限(例如用户信息,那就是它)因此显示用户允许我在弹出窗口中执行的项目较少?

1 个答案:

答案 0 :(得分:5)

登录https://dev.twitter.com/apps,选择应用程序,然后在设置标签上将access切换为read only。这将删除Update your profilePost Tweets for you权限。 Twitter OAuth始终存在前两个权限。